>> My application was fully developed in Beehive. Actually it is a migration
>> project.
>>
>> i deployed the business logic on Jboss and presentation logic on
>> Weblogic,
>> For reference i have Home and Remote classes in the local side. The
>> implementation of Bean placed in Jboss.
>> on my idea to invoke the bean method the interpreter appends the "impl"
>> string to TLMDAORemote interface and searches for "TLMDAORemoteImpl"
>> class, i placed this class in Jboss, but it is searching for this class
>> in
>> Weblogic
>> I have given the URL as jnp://10.233.39.137, so that it goes there
>> and searches for the Bean class.
>>
>> But its not happening so.
>> Requesting to Help me out in achiving my requirement.
>>
>> @ControlExtension
>> @EJBHome(jndiName="TLMDAOBeehive")
>> @JNDIContextEnv(contextFactory="org.jnp.interfaces.NamingContextFactory",providerURL="jnp://10.233.39.137")
>> public interface TLMDBEJB extends
>> TLMDAOHome,TLMDAORemote,SessionEJBControl
>> {
>> }
>>
>> @ControlInterface
>> public interface TLMDAORemote extends EJBObject
>> {
>> public java.util.HashMap getDetails(long corrAccNo, long gin) throws
>> RemoteException, java.sql.SQLException, java.lang.Exception;
>> }
>>
>> public interface TLMDAOHome extends EJBHome {
>> public TLMDAORemote create() throws CreateException, RemoteException;
>> }
>>
>> @ControlImplementation(isTransient=true)
>> public class TLMDAORemoteImpl implements SessionBean,TLMDAORemote
>> {
>> .
>> .
>> }
>>
>> For you information, its working fine if all the layers are deployed on
>> the
>> same server.
>> i.e., in a single .ear file.
